Book Review: Murder in the Appalachians by Susan Furlong

 


Murder in the Appalachians by Susan Furlong - 4 Stars 

This is probably my favorite love inspired romantic suspense book I have read so far! Really enjoyed the setting and fast paced suspense. Just the right pallet cleanse I needed. This was a random NetGalley ARC request and I am glad I requested it! 

We follow Emma Hayes who is seeking answers after her brothers mysterious death - she goes back to get her brother's police notebook but someone was there looking for it themselves....she takes off and ends up off a riverbank. She wakes up to local ER doctor Logan Greer who is trying to help keep her safe and alive. He is helping her figure out what is going on, who is after her and who killed her brother....but everywhere they turn.....a killer could be right on them hiding in the mountains. 

The faith content in this stands out, there's a great moment where Emma cries out to the Lord - really emotional for her and you as the reader. Really liked the backstory too of how Logan was technically connected to her brother and that situation, very interesting. This is one of those feel good, quick romance reads that you just need sometimes. :)
